CM351 Shotgun Replica
Shotgun series by Cyma has the same characteristic features as all other products from this brand. Those values include solid craftsmanship, good performance and reasonable price range. CM352 is a spring action replica of a shotgun and, what’s important, has 3 inner barrels! This allows for firing 3 BBs at once, which directly results in greater advantage on the battlefield. Especially during CQB airsoft skirmishes (although not only!). A 6mm BB is loaded into a shell replica of capacity up to 30 BBs, which is in turn placed in the chamber of the replica. All that gives the gun additional levels of realism.
Specific elements of the replica have been very well fitted together. Parts made from ZnAl include: inner barrel, grip slide, shell ejection flap, tactical sling swivels, barrel clasp, bullet chamber flap. Remaining parts such as pistol grip, body, sliding forearm handle were made from durable polymer.
The sliding forearm due to anti-slip texture is very comfortable in use and its operation very smooth – after a bit of training one can provide quick and steady fire. A BB fired from all 3 barrels is slightly curled up, which makes the shot more effective.
A safety and bullet chamber lock button are located right next to the trigger, which makes their operation very quick and intuitive. CM351 has no stock, which makes it ultra compact tool for combat, for instance, in tight spaces.
The replica is compatible with 30 BB shells from other manufacturers, such as: GFC Guns and Double Eagle.

Hop-Up system is used for overclocking bb during the shot (putting it in rotation), through which, it extends its flight path. Acting laws of physics make that bb lift up, while the gravitational force take it down. Appropriate adjustment of Hop-Up, will compensate for these two factors, which result in long and straight flight for longer distance and be greater focus shot (to improve accuracy).
